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the polishing of metal is desirable for an attractive appearance or clean-room application. It's among the most preferred treatments for its use in developing the natural attractiveness of the items, for example, car parts, cookware or motorcycle parts. Furthermore, plenty of clean-rooms demand a burnished finish in order to limit the permeability of the components that may cause particles to collect and contaminate. An outstanding instance of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. There exist a great many strategies to polish metals, and let us have a review of examples of the processes required. Metals may be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A particular finishing paste or compound is usually utilized, which may include ch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scosity is amongst the time-consuming. On the other side, items manufactured from non-ferrous metals will be more responsive to polishing, as they call for the lower number of processes.
If a greater processing quality is simply not essential, swifter pad speeds should be employed. A reduced pad speed must be used should a high quality mirror finish is called for. Polishing buffs daubed with paste can be dramatically impacted by the pressures on the surface of the pad. The strength of the pressure on the surface can be amplified to a definite scope, however overreaching the maximum degree of load not just reduces the quality of treatment, but additionally can worsen effectiveness, may well cause wear to the component, plus there is also an evident overheating of the pieces being worked on, because of friction. With thin material, it is elevated temperature (and a corresponding pliability of the material) that can cause materials to distort, twist or bend. As a rule, it requires a seasoned technician to think about every one of these elements to equally avert harm to the metal part and to perform competently. In order to appreciably improve the standard of the resulting finish, the finishing procedure is required to be implemented with much less power and not a large amount of force in order to in time complete a surface that doesn't have any scratches or marks coming from the polishing procedure, thereby arriving at a sparkling mirror finish.
